Responsibilities:
The Associate Scientist works closely with team of scientists and senior scientists to plan and perform laboratory assignments in the development of product formulations, measurement of physical properties, validation of performance and analysis of products. The individual draws conclusions based on data, proposes and directs next steps in the development plan and is responsible to drive development activities. The individual further functions as part of an integrated cross functional team.
• Execute experimental designs to optimize prototypes to meet desired performance metrics.
• Record detailed observations and data from experiments performed. Keep lab notebook records current and in good order as a working legal document.
• Draw preliminary conclusions and present to management.
• Contribute to the solution of assigned problems through development/modification of test procedures.
• Run standard and non-standard chemical, physical, or application tests to obtain data to evaluate composition of products.
• Check and maintains inventories of raw materials and supplies and maintain work spaces.
• Responsible for safe working conditions (handles dangerous equipment and hazardous chemicals). Is aware of hazards associated with work assigned, observes safe work practices, keeps equipment neat, clean and in safe operating condition, and maintains good housekeeping standards.
• Responsible for following all applicable Federal, State, and Local health, safety, and environmental regulations, as per corporate health, safety and environmental policies.
